Lake Elsinore/Temecula Sheriff's Mounted Posse Lake Elsinore and Temecula Mounted Posse are divisions of the Riverside County Sheriff Departments Mounted Posse Unit.

We are comprised of volunteer horse men and women who provide security detail, crowd control and public relations to our community.

Next up for our get to know our members series is Marine Corps veteran, Jolene. Jolene has been on the posse for 1 year and is currently serving as our secretary. She joined because she has a passion for serving her community and enjoys the camaraderie that the mounted posse offers. She is thankful for the training opportunities that keep her, and her horse prepared to safely be of service.

Jolene has been around horses since she was 6 and participated in the Lake Elsinore Rodeo Queen competitions for a few years in her youth.

Her partner in preventing crime is Koda. She’s a 9-year-old seal brown bay Andalusian Quarter Horse, “Azteca”. She likes getting out to see new places and being of service during community events. Koda loves getting to see all the kids and adults that come up to pet her and if she really likes you, she will curl her neck around you for a big horse hug.
They are both looking forward to continuing posse training to be prepared for bigger events in the future.

Next up for our get to know our members series is Sharalyn. Sharalyn has been on the posse for 1 year and is currently servicing as our Vice President. She joined because she recently became an empty nesters and since her family all serve in similar fields the mounted pose was a natural fit for her.

Sharalyn loved horses since she was a child and got her first one when she was in 7th grade at boarding school. Her love for horses has continued to last her lifetime.

Her partner in preventing crime is, Tango. He is a 7 year old Paint. He is a super sweet and loves being around people and loves being a posse horse.

Sharalyn is looking forward to many more years of serving her community as a proud posse member.

Ready to get to know some of our awesome members?
First off we will start with Deborah Casteel. She joined the Lake Elsinore mounted posse in 2015 and is now serving as President of the troop. She joined because she wanted to be able to do something with her horse while also helping people. Her favorite things about serving is being able to interact with the community.

She grew up around the racetracks where her dad was a race horse trainer and that sparked her love for horses that has lasted a lifetime.

She is currently serving with her partner in preventing crime, Duke. He is 25 year old Appaloosa. She is borrowing him from another posse member since her most faithful servant and life long horse friend, Wyatt, got to retire just last year. Wyatt is 24 year old Passofino, that is enjoying his well earned retirement.
